Look up S.T.E.P. it's a great modding guide. It provides very good information on each mod as well as different levels of modablilty. E.g. you can install the 'Core' mods and improve the base Skyrim experience. Then move on to Extended etc. There's too many mods to recommend, it's best to just look up a guide on mods and recommended mods and mix and match. It also depends on what you're looking for too.

 

*Edit*

 

Use Steam Workshop for easibility, but it has a small amounts of mods compared to Nexus. Install is simply subscribe and wait for the download.

Use Nexus if you want to get the most out of your game and want to take care and pride in your modding experience :P It takes ages to get heaps of mods and get them all properly working, but it is well worth it.
